- База данных для приложений Windows — современные решения и лучшие практики
- Данные для windows приложения: Как использовать и улучшить базу данных
- Разработка эффективной структуры базы данных для windows приложений
- Выбор подходящей СУБД для windows приложений
- Оптимизация базы данных для улучшения производительности Windows приложений
- Масштабирование базы данных для удовлетворения потребностей Windows приложений
- Обеспечение безопасности и защиты данных в базе данных для windows приложений
- Заключение
База данных для приложений Windows — современные решения и лучшие практики
В современном мире, где все буквально связано с технологией, базы данных играют важную роль в создании и управлении приложениями. Одним из самых популярных вариантов является база данных для приложений Windows, которая обеспечивает надежное хранение и организацию данных для работы приложений под управлением операционной системы Windows.
База данных для приложений Windows предоставляет мощный инструментарий для разработчиков, позволяя им создавать высокопроизводительные и эффективные приложения с помощью современных технологий. Эти базы данных поддерживают широкий спектр функций и возможностей, включая масштабируемость, безопасность, репликацию данных и удобный интерфейс для работы с данными.
Одним из наиболее популярных типов баз данных для приложений Windows являются реляционные СУБД, такие как MySQL, PostgreSQL и Microsoft SQL Server. Они предоставляют удобные средства для создания и управления таблицами, выполнения сложных запросов и обеспечения целостности данных. Однако, в зависимости от задачи и требований приложения, можно выбрать и другие типы баз данных, такие как NoSQL или встроенные базы данных.
Важно отметить, что при выборе базы данных для приложения Windows следует учитывать не только ее функциональные возможности, но и требования к производительности, масштабируемости, безопасности и доступности данных. Кроме того, разработчики должны учитывать ограничения и особенности выбранной базы данных, чтобы гарантировать эффективную работу приложения и удовлетворение потребностей пользователей.
В этой статье мы рассмотрим основные аспекты баз данных для приложений Windows, поможем вам понять их роль и значение в разработке, а также дадим рекомендации по выбору и использованию наиболее подходящей базы данных для вашего приложения. Независимо от того, являетесь ли вы начинающим разработчиком или опытным специалистом, эта статья поможет вам освоить все необходимые знания для эффективного создания приложений под управлением операционной системы Windows.
Мы более не можем игнорировать важность баз данных в мире информационных технологий, и база данных для приложений Windows является надежным и эффективным инструментом для хранения и управления данными. Продолжайте чтение этой статьи, чтобы узнать больше о базах данных для приложений Windows и стать экспертом в этой области!
Данные для windows приложения: Как использовать и улучшить базу данных
Одним из ключевых аспектов использования базы данных в Windows-приложении является выбор подходящей системы управления базами данных (СУБД). СУБД предоставляет средства для создания и обработки базы данных, а также выполняет запросы к данным. В Windows-приложении можно использовать различные СУБД, такие как Microsoft SQL Server, SQLite, MySQL и другие. При выборе СУБД необходимо учитывать требования приложения, его масштабируемость и ожидаемую нагрузку на базу данных.
Для улучшения базы данных в Windows-приложении следует обратить внимание на оптимизацию запросов. Это позволит ускорить обработку данных и повысить производительность приложения в целом. Одним из способов оптимизации запросов является использование индексов. Индексы позволяют ускорить поиск данных в базе данных путем создания специальных структур для быстрого доступа к данным. Однако не следует злоупотреблять использованием индексов, так как большое количество индексов может замедлить обновление данных.
- Выбор подходящей СУБД: При выборе системы управления базами данных для Windows-приложения необходимо учитывать требования приложения, его масштабируемость и ожидаемую нагрузку на базу данных.
- Оптимизация запросов: Для повышения производительности приложения следует обратить внимание на оптимизацию запросов, например, использование индексов для ускорения поиска данных.
- Ограничение использования индексов: Не следует злоупотреблять использованием индексов, так как большое количество индексов может замедлить обновление данных в базе данных.
В целом, правильное использование и улучшение базы данных является важным аспектом при разработке Windows-приложения. Оно позволяет сделать приложение более эффективным, надежным и удобным для пользователей.
Разработка эффективной структуры базы данных для windows приложений
Первым шагом при разработке эффективной структуры базы данных является определение требований и целей приложения. Необходимо понять, какие данные приложение должно хранить и как эти данные будут использоваться в дальнейшем. Затем можно определить основные таблицы и связи между ними.
Очень важно правильно спроектировать таблицы и их поля. Необходимо учесть типы данных, ограничения, индексы и другие атрибуты, которые могут повлиять на производительность и эффективность работы базы данных. Кроме того, стоит обратить внимание на нормализацию данных, чтобы избежать избыточности и дублирования информации.
Для улучшения производительности базы данных можно использовать индексы. Индексы позволяют быстро находить и извлекать нужную информацию из базы данных. Разработчикам следует анализировать запросы к базе данных и определять, какие поля нуждаются в индексировании для быстрого доступа к данным.
Кроме того, разработчикам следует обратить внимание на оптимизацию запросов к базе данных. Необходимо избегать излишнего использования JOIN операций, а также аккуратно организовывать условия в WHERE выражениях. Это поможет снизить нагрузку на базу данных и улучшить производительность приложения.
В целом, разработка эффективной структуры базы данных для windows приложений требует внимательного анализа требований и проектирования таблиц и их связей. Такой подход поможет обеспечить корректную работу программы и эффективное хранение данных. С учетом оптимизации запросов и использованием индексов, можно значительно улучшить производительность и эффективность базы данных в windows приложениях.
Выбор подходящей СУБД для windows приложений
При выборе СУБД для Windows-приложения нужно учитывать несколько факторов. Во-первых, необходимо определить, какие типы данных будут храниться в базе данных. Если приложение работает с простыми данными, такими как текстовые строки или числа, то простая и легковесная СУБД может быть достаточной. Однако, если приложение работает с более сложными типами данных, такими как изображения, аудио или видео, необходимо выбрать СУБД, способную эффективно работать с такими данными.
Один из важных факторов при выборе СУБД для Windows-приложения — это его производительность. Быстрый доступ к данным в базе данных является критически важным для обеспечения отзывчивости приложения. Поэтому следует выбирать СУБД, которая предлагает эффективные механизмы индексации и оптимизации запросов, что позволит приложению быстро обращаться к данным.
- Важное влияние на выбор СУБД для Windows-приложений оказывает также масштабируемость. Если планируется расширение приложения в будущем и увеличение объемов хранимых данных, необходимо выбирать СУБД, способную масштабироваться и обеспечивать хорошую производительность даже при больших объемах данных.
- Другим важным фактором является совместимость с платформой Windows. СУБД должна иметь хорошую поддержку для Windows-среды разработки и уметь интегрироваться с другими компонентами Windows-приложения.
- Вопросы безопасности также играют важную роль при выборе СУБД для Windows-приложения. База данных должна предлагать механизмы защиты данных, такие как шифрование и контроль доступа, чтобы обеспечить конфиденциальность и целостность данных.
В итоге, выбор подходящей СУБД для Windows-приложений — это компромисс, который зависит от конкретных требований приложения. Необходимо внимательно исследовать различные варианты СУБД, учитывая требования по производительности, функциональности, масштабируемости и безопасности, чтобы выбрать наиболее подходящий вариант.
Оптимизация базы данных для улучшения производительности Windows приложений
Оптимизация базы данных включает в себя ряд мер и подходов, которые помогают улучшить ее производительность. Во-первых, необходимо провести анализ схемы базы данных и определить, какие таблицы, столбцы и индексы являются наиболее часто запрашиваемыми и используемыми. Затем следует оптимизировать структуру базы данных, устранить дублирующиеся данные и провести нормализацию для сокращения объема хранимых данных.
Для оптимизации производительности Windows приложений также важно правильно настроить индексы в базе данных. Индексы позволяют быстро находить необходимые данные и ускоряют выполнение запросов. Оптимально использовать индексы на столбцах, по которым часто происходят поисковые или сортировочные операции. Кроме того, следует учитывать, что перебор большого количества индексов может привести к замедлению работы базы данных, поэтому их следует создавать с умом.
- Анализировать и оптимизировать структуру базы данных.
- Удалять дублирующиеся данные и проводить нормализацию.
- Настроить индексы в базе данных.
Еще одним важным аспектом оптимизации базы данных является использование параметризованных запросов. Вместо прямого включения пользовательских данных в SQL запросы, следует использовать параметры, что позволяет избежать возможности SQL инъекций и улучшает безопасность приложения в целом.
В конечном итоге, оптимизация базы данных для улучшения производительности Windows приложений является сложным и важным процессом. Следует проводить постоянный анализ и мониторинг работы базы данных, применять передовые техники оптимизации и настраивать базу данных в соответствии с требованиями и потребностями конкретного приложения.
Масштабирование базы данных для удовлетворения потребностей Windows приложений
Одним из главных преимуществ масштабируемых баз данных является возможность обработки большого количества запросов со стабильной производительностью. Благодаря масштабированию, база данных может эффективно справляться с растущим объемом данных и увеличивающимся количеством пользователей. Это позволяет улучшить отзывчивость приложения и обеспечить бесперебойную работу системы даже при значительной нагрузке.
Еще одним важным аспектом масштабирования базы данных для Windows приложений является обеспечение высокой доступности данных. В случае отказа одного сервера, масштабируемая база данных может переключиться на другие серверы и продолжить работу без потери данных или простоя. Это обеспечивает непрерывность работы приложения и удовлетворяет ожидания пользователей, которые требуют постоянного доступа к информации.
Обеспечение безопасности и защиты данных в базе данных для windows приложений
Базы данных играют ключевую роль в современных windows приложениях, поскольку они обеспечивают эффективное хранение и управление данными. Однако с ростом объема и важности данных, безопасность и защита стали наиболее критическими аспектами для разработчиков и пользователей.
Обеспечение безопасности данных в базе данных имеет решающее значение для предотвращения несанкционированного доступа к информации. Для достижения этой цели разработчики должны применять специальные механизмы безопасности, такие как аутентификация и авторизация пользователей, шифрование данных, контроль доступа и регистрация изменений. Эти меры обеспечивают сохранность данных и предотвращают возможные угрозы.
Кроме того, обеспечение защиты данных является неотъемлемой частью безопасности базы данных. Защита данных предусматривает меры по предотвращению потери, повреждения или уничтожения информации. Разработчики могут применять методы резервного копирования данных, механизмы восстановления после сбоев и репликацию данных, чтобы гарантировать сохранность информации в случае аварийных ситуаций.
Важно отметить, что обеспечение безопасности и защиты данных должно быть встроено в саму базу данных и ее архитектуру. Разработчики должны придерживаться лучших практик и стандартов безопасности, чтобы гарантировать надежность и защиту данных пользователей. Также необходимо регулярно обновлять и обслуживать базу данных, чтобы исправлять уязвимости и предотвращать возможные атаки.
Заключение
Аналитика данных помогает определить паттерны использования базы данных, выявить проблемные запросы и улучшить их производительность. С помощью аналитики можно анализировать объемы данных, предсказывать и прогнозировать рост нагрузки, осуществлять мониторинг работы базы данных и быстро реагировать на возникающие проблемы.
Оптимальная работа базы данных приводит к повышению производительности приложения, снижению задержек и улучшению пользовательского опыта. Аналитика данных позволяет выявить потенциальные проблемы, планировать программные обновления и масштабирование базы данных. Все это помогает обеспечить бесперебойную работу windows приложений и удовлетворение потребностей пользователей.